Book SynopsisUntil quite recently, Vygotskya s work was known only to a small circle of Western psychologists, but he has rapidly emerged as one of the major theorists of the twentieth century. This new volume aims to provide students and scholars alike with a lively introduction to Vygotskya s work based on authoritative translations of the original sources.
